Cost-Effectiveness: Comparing the Financial Facets of Oral Implants and Dentures



If you're taking into consideration dental implants or dentures, you may be questioning which choice is much more cost-efficient. When it involves set you back, it is essential to consider both the first financial investment and the long-term costs.

Oral implants tend to have a higher in advance price compared to dentures. This is due to the fact that the process of implant positioning entails surgery and the use of high-grade materials. They're much more durable and can last a life time with appropriate care, reducing the demand for frequent replacements or repairs.

On the other hand, dentures may have a reduced first expense, however they may call for adjustments, relining, and even replacement with time, which can build up in regards to recurring costs.

Inevitably, the cost-effectiveness of oral implants versus dentures depends upon your individual requirements and preferences, in addition to your lasting dental wellness goals.

Long life: Understanding the Toughness and Life Expectancy of Dental Implants and Dentures



Think about the long life and life expectancy of dental implants and dentures when making a decision which option is right for you. Both oral implants and dentures have their own durability and life-span, and it is very important to comprehend these factors prior to making a decision.

Below are 4 key points to take into consideration:

1. Implants: Dental implants are created to be a permanent option for missing teeth. With appropriate treatment and maintenance, they can last a lifetime. This is because implants are operatively positioned in the jawbone, providing a stable foundation for artificial te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are detachable devices that replace missing out on teeth. While they can be an economical choice, they generally have a shorter life-span contrasted to implants. Dentures may require to be changed every 5-7 years due to wear and tear.

3. Upkeep: Dental implants call for normal cleaning, flossing, and dental exams, much like natural teeth. Dentures call for everyday cleansing and soaking to avoid bacteria accumulation.

Oral Wellness Advantages: Analyzing the Influence of Oral Implants and Dentures on Total Oral Health And Wellness



Preserving proper oral health is critical in evaluating the impact of dental implants and dentures on your general oral health and wellness.



Oral implants offer considerable dental wellness benefits as they work like all-natural teeth, boosting the jawbone and avoiding bone loss. This helps in keeping the framework and honesty of your jaw, which subsequently supports your face functions.

With oral implants, you can take pleasure in a much more all-natural attacking and chewing experience, permitting you to consume a broader series of foods pleasantly. Furthermore, oral implants do not need any type of unique cleansing techniques; you can simply brush and floss them like your nat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ures require unique treatment and cleaning, as they need to be gotten rid of and cleaned individually. Dentures can additionally cause gum tissue irritation and discomfort if not correctly fitted.
